Parallelograms/714951: If someone draws a parallelogram and measures 120 degrees what is the measure of the three angles
1 solutions

Answer 439080 by jim_thompson5910(28598) About Me  on 2013-02-15 17:59:00 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
The adjacent angle is supplementary to the given angle. So the adjacent angle is 180 - 120 = 60 degrees

The angle opposite the 120 degree angle is also 120 degrees.

The angle opposite the 60 degree angle is also 60 degrees.

So the four angles are: 120, 60, 120, 60

Which means that the given angle is 120, while the other 3 angles are 60, 120, 60

Probability-and-statistics/714861: Given:
P(A) = 0.4
P(B) = 0.24
P(A ∪ B) = 0.56
Find P(A ∩ B)
1 solutions

Answer 439040 by jim_thompson5910(28598) About Me  on 2013-02-15 15:45:14 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
P(A ∩ B) = P(A) + P(B) - P(A ∪ B)

P(A ∩ B) = 0.4 + 0.24 - 0.56

P(A ∩ B) = 0.08

Probability-and-statistics/714753: According to a recent study, 1 in every 6 women has been a victim of domestic abuse at some point in her life. Suppose we have randomly and independently sampled 25 women and asked each whether she has been a victim of domestic abuse at some point in her life. Find the probability that more than 22 of the women sampled have not been the victim of domestic abuse.
Would like to see the formula that gives the answer 0.188687
1 solutions

Answer 438959 by jim_thompson5910(28598) About Me  on 2013-02-15 00:47:24 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Let X = number of women who have not been the victim of domestic abuse

So each trial has a probability of 1 - 1/6 = 5/6 = 0.83333333333333

So

p = 0.83333333333333

n = 25

Now compute the following probabilities P(X = 23), P(X = 24), P(X = 25)




P(X = k) = (n C k)*(p)^(k)*(1-p)^(n-k)
P(X = 23) = (25 C 23)*(0.83333333333333)^(23)*(1-0.83333333333333)^(25-23)
P(X = 23) = (25 C 23)*(0.83333333333333)^(23)*(0.16666666666667)^(25-23)
P(X = 23) = (300)*(0.83333333333333)^(23)*(0.16666666666667)^2
P(X = 23) = (300)*(0.015094938254969)*(0.0277777777777789)
P(X = 23) = 0.125791152124747


P(X = k) = (n C k)*(p)^(k)*(1-p)^(n-k)
P(X = 24) = (25 C 24)*(0.83333333333333)^(24)*(1-0.83333333333333)^(25-24)
P(X = 24) = (25 C 24)*(0.83333333333333)^(24)*(0.16666666666667)^(25-24)
P(X = 24) = (25)*(0.83333333333333)^(24)*(0.16666666666667)^1
P(X = 24) = (25)*(0.0125791152124741)*(0.16666666666667)
P(X = 24) = 0.0524129800519766


P(X = k) = (n C k)*(p)^(k)*(1-p)^(n-k)
P(X = 25) = (25 C 25)*(0.83333333333333)^(25)*(1-0.83333333333333)^(25-25)
P(X = 25) = (25 C 25)*(0.83333333333333)^(25)*(0.16666666666667)^(25-25)
P(X = 25) = (1)*(0.83333333333333)^(25)*(0.16666666666667)^0
P(X = 25) = (1)*(0.0104825960103951)*(1)
P(X = 25) = 0.0104825960103951


-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

To summarize, we found the following


P(X = 23)= 0.125791152124747
P(X = 24)= 0.0524129800519766
P(X = 25)= 0.0104825960103951


Now add up the individual probabilities to find P(X > 22)

P(X > 22) = P(X = 23)+P(X = 24)+P(X = 25)

P(X > 22) = 0.125791152124747+0.0524129800519766+0.0104825960103951

P(X > 22) = 0.18868672818711

So the probability that more than 22 of the women sampled have not been the victim of domestic abuse is roughly 0.18868672818711

If you want to round to 6 decimal places, you would get 0.188687

Probability-and-statistics/714240: Without dividing find the decimal equivalent of 6/25. Explain how you found your answer
1 solutions

Answer 438728 by jim_thompson5910(28598) About Me  on 2013-02-13 17:46:09 (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Multiply top and bottom by 4 to get 24/100. Why 4? Because 25*4 = 100.

So 24/100 = 0.24 because 0.24 means 24 hundredths (ie 24 out of a 100)

So 6/25 = 0.24
